Description
As a Senior Technical Sourcer at OpenAI, you will play a key role in identifying and engaging top-tier engineering talent across a broad range of technical domains. Your focus will be on sourcing exceptional software engineers and technical talent to help build world-class teams advancing our mission in AI research and deployment.
In this role, you will:
- Lead sourcing strategies to identify and engage candidates across a variety of engineering disciplines, including software engineering, backend systems, product engineering, and related technical areas.
- Develop and maintain a strong pipeline of passive candidates through proactive outreach, research, and networking.
- Collaborate closely with hiring managers and technical leaders to deeply understand hiring needs and refine sourcing approaches accordingly.
- Leverage advanced sourcing techniques and tools to identify and attract exceptional talent.
- Represent OpenAI at industry events and conferences to promote our mission and connect with potential candidates.
- Maintain accurate and organized candidate data and metrics to inform sourcing strategies and decision-making.
You might thrive in this role if you have:
- 5+ years of experience in technical sourcing, with a focus on engineering or technical roles.
- A proven track record of successfully sourcing candidates across a range of software engineering and technical disciplines.
- A strong understanding of technical concepts and the ability to effectively communicate role requirements to candidates.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build trust with both candidates and internal stakeholders.
- Proficiency with sourcing tools and platforms, including LinkedIn Recruiter and applicant tracking systems.
- The ability to manage multiple priorities and adapt quickly in a fast-paced, evolving environment.
